FRANKFORT, KY. (ABC36 NEWS NOW) – Kentucky First Lady Britainy Beshear led a ceremony Wednesday morning recognizing Domestic Violence Awareness Month. She was joined by State Representative Samara Heavrin and advocates from ZeroV and OASIS.
The event included a special tribute honoring Kentuckians who lost their lives to intimate partner homicide over the past year.
During the ceremony, the Governor’s proclamation designating October as Domestic Violence Awareness Month was also presented.
The event took place at the Capitol Education Center in Frankfort and was livestreamed on the ZeroV Facebook page.
